Right or left? Side selection for a totally implantable vascular access device: a randomised observational study

Summary
The implantation side of totally implantable vascular access devices (TIVADs) does not affect thrombotic or occlusion events in cancer patients. This finding suggests TIVAD placement side is not a risk factor for these complications.

Background:
- Complications from totally implantable vascular access devices (TIVADs) disrupt cancer treatment and increase healthcare costs.
- Investigating the impact of TIVAD implantation side on thrombotic or occlusion events is crucial for patient care.
Purpose of the Study:
- To determine if the side of central line TIVAD implantation influences the occurrence of thrombotic or occlusion events.
- To assess the relationship between TIVAD placement side and catheter-related complications in cancer patients.
Main Methods:
- A randomized controlled trial involving cancer patients requiring central line TIVADs.
- Patients were randomized to receive TIVAD implantation on either the left or right side.
- The primary endpoint was the incidence of catheter-related thrombotic or occlusion events.
Main Results:
- Out of 235 patients in the per-protocol cohort, 9 (4%) experienced catheter-related thrombotic or occlusion events.
- No significant difference was observed in the occurrence rates or timing of events between left- and right-sided implantations (P=0.333 and P=0.328, respectively).
- Multivariate analysis confirmed that the implantation side was not associated with thrombotic or occlusion events.
Conclusions:
- The side of central line TIVAD implantation is not linked to the development of catheter-related thrombotic or occlusion events.
- This study indicates that TIVAD placement side does not represent a modifiable risk factor for these common complications in cancer patients.
